Riyadh Launches Non-Paid Managed Parking in Residential Neighborhoods

The Riyadh Parking Project has initiated the first phase of its non-paid managed parking initiative in residential neighborhoods.

This effort is part of a broader plan to organize public vehicle parking and address issues such as the overflow of cars from commercial areas into nearby housing districts.

Objectives of the Initiative

  • Enhance Parking Efficiency: Improve the management of parking spaces and reduce unauthorized vehicle use in residential areas.
  • Improve Urban Experience: Create a more organized and pleasant environment for residents.

Key Features

  • Digital Residential Parking Permits: Residents and their guests can obtain parking permits through the Riyadh Parking mobile app.
  • Link to Nafath Platform: The app is integrated with the national Nafath platform for secure registration and access.
  • Initial Rollout Area: The program begins in the Al-Wurud neighborhood, with plans to expand to additional areas near commercial streets.

Advanced Monitoring Technology

The project employs advanced technology, including:

  • Smart Patrol Vehicles: Equipped with Automated License Plate Recognition (ALPR) cameras to monitor parking violations in both commercial zones and surrounding neighborhoods.

Scale of the Project

Launched in August 2024, the Riyadh Parking Project is among the largest smart parking initiatives globally, aiming to:

  • Regulate over 140,000 non-paid residential parking spaces.
  • Manage 24,000 paid spots in commercial districts.

Phase One Coverage

Phase one includes 12 zones in neighborhoods such as:

  • Al-Wurud
  • Al-Rahmaniyah
  • West Olaya
  • Al-Muruj
  • King Fahd
  • Al-Sulaimaniah
